The Pythagorean theorem can be used to find a missing length of any triangle. True False

Respuesta :

0o9i8u7y6t5r4e3w2q1 0o9i8u7y6t5r4e3w2q1
  • 23-06-2016
False it can only be used with triangles that have a right angle
